Back to work this week, first tree up was this little Birch out in Winchester.
Client didn't want the Hibiscus which is directly under the lean of the birch. The Hibiscus came from the originals planted decades ago by Patsy Cline, so it couldn't be harmed.
Also the client wanted the boxwoods kept basically intact, so I had to do my best to avoid those as well. Behind me down the hill was more Hibiscus and beneath the lean of course was the concrete wall and a very expensive shed with a brand new metal roof.
So tight squeeze. I topped it first, then dropped the spar in between the shed, wall and boxwoods. This video clip is dropping the trunk.
